Transaction 640275a0083232d30a3778f18848878c2d3ef7ccece97f4186690861377cb304
1 Input
1 Output
-
640275a0083232d30a3778f18848878c2d3ef7ccece97f4186690861377cb304:0
- value
- 126439
- script pubkey
- OP_0 OP_PUSHBYTES_32 651ddf3753cef3db2140c155fe49f6f772cb5c46119ae73cb3a60ee6991627e8
- address
- bc1qv5wa7d6nemeakg2qc92luj0k7aevkhzxzxdww09n5c8wdxgkyl5q6rxjqu